Dear FSU Member,

Voting for the FSU elections will begin at 9am Monday (3/23) and will conclude 9am Monday (3/30). This Monday morning you will receive an email with an individualized link to your ballot. You will use this link to cast your ballot for both President and your respective faculty or librarian rank, if applicable. We want to remind you that there is no election for a Pre Tenure Representative.

Dear FSU members, 

We are launching a petition campaign in support of one of our members who has been slated for termination in what we believe is an act of retaliation for union activity and critiques of the administration. We demand that Provost Joseph Berger reinstate Professor Keith Jones NOW!
